Eugene, OR. • Create accessible literature derived from complex academic research ...If you are a mandatory reporter, you must report suspicions of child abuse or neglect to authorities. Call the abuse hotline at 855-503-SAFE (7233) to make a report. Child Welfare Information GatewayThe Child Welfare Data Book is the Oregon Department of Human Services' annual report of child abuse and neglect statistics. It also includes Oregon adoption data f or children who are not in ODHS custody.
